Buddhists in Hong Kong pray against spread of COVID-19

Description

Hong Kong, Feb 18 (EFE/EPA).- Ngawang Kunga Tenzin Gyatso Rinpoche on Tuesday led a prayer and offered blessings against spread of COVID-19 to Hong Kong at the start of a Buddha Sunning Festival.The city is dealing with the novel coronavirus that causes the disease known as COVID-19. As of 18 February a total of 61 people were infected in Hong Kong, while in mainland China the number of cases leapt to more than 72,000 and the death toll was at least 1,860.
